Scope and Contents
The first twelve volumes consist of the minutes of the Executive Committee (1912-1920, 1927-1929) and the minutes of the Managing/Managers/Management Committee (1924-1931). They give a top level view of operations at the Camden facility down to RCA Victor's reorganization and abolition of the Management Committee on February 18, 1931. They cover the entire gamut of activities, including financial statements, levels of output, plant construction, approvals of Victrola designs and prices, production levels, purchases of materials, real estate, patents and patent suits, trademarks and advertising. Of particular note are the approvals of recording contracts with various artists, many still famous, including the length of the contract and payments.
